Introduction to Air Greenland
Air Greenland, the national airline of Greenland, plays a crucial role in connecting the remote and vast landscapes of this Arctic territory to the rest of the world. With a fleet size of approximately 15 aircraft, Air Greenland operates a diverse range of aircraft types, including the Airbus A330-200, Bombardier Dash 8 Q400, and the Sikorsky S-92 helicopter. The average age of the fleet is around 10 years, showcasing a balance between modern efficiency and operational reliability.
The airline's primary hub is located at Nuuk Airport (GOH), which serves as a focal point for both domestic and international flights. Additionally, Kangerlussuaq Airport (SFJ) acts as a significant gateway for transatlantic flights, connecting Greenland to major cities in North America and Europe. The airline's network spans over 30 destinations across Greenland and connects to key international cities, including Copenhagen (CPH) and Reykjavik (KEF), facilitating travel for both residents and tourists.
Annually, Air Greenland serves approximately 200,000 passengers, demonstrating its vital role in the region's transportation infrastructure. The airline's operational strengths lie in its punctuality and regional presence, as it effectively manages to maintain a high on-time performance rate despite the challenging weather conditions often faced in the Arctic region.
Strategically, Air Greenland has established partnerships with various airlines, including SAS and Air Iceland, to enhance its connectivity and expand its reach. These alliances allow for seamless travel options for passengers, making it easier to navigate the complexities of air travel in and out of Greenland.
